IM解决方案如何支持跨操作系统?
随着信息技术的飞速发展,跨操作系统已经成为企业信息化建设的重要需求。IM(即时通讯)解决方案作为企业内部沟通的重要工具,如何支持跨操作系统,成为了众多企业关注的焦点。本文将从以下几个方面探讨IM解决方案如何支持跨操作系统。
一、跨操作系统平台的选择
移动端:目前,主流的移动操作系统有iOS和Android。在选择IM解决方案时,应确保其支持这两个平台,以满足不同用户的需求。
PC端:Windows、macOS和Linux是当前主流的PC操作系统。IM解决方案应支持这些操作系统,以便用户在多种设备上使用。
Web端:Web端IM解决方案具有跨平台、易部署、易维护等优势,能够满足不同用户的需求。
二、跨操作系统兼容性
编程语言:IM解决方案应采用跨平台编程语言,如Java、C#等,以确保在不同操作系统上运行稳定。
库和框架:选择成熟的跨平台库和框架,如Qt、Electron等,可以降低开发难度,提高兼容性。
硬件加速:针对不同操作系统,采用硬件加速技术,提高IM解决方案的运行效率。
三、跨操作系统数据同步
云端存储:将用户数据存储在云端,实现跨操作系统数据同步。用户可以在任意设备上登录IM解决方案,查看、发送消息等。
本地存储:针对部分用户对隐私保护的需求,可以提供本地存储功能。用户可以在本地存储消息、联系人等信息,实现跨操作系统数据同步。
数据加密:在数据传输和存储过程中,采用加密技术,确保用户数据安全。
四、跨操作系统用户体验
界面适配:针对不同操作系统,优化IM解决方案的界面设计,确保用户在使用过程中获得良好的视觉体验。
操作便捷:简化操作流程,降低用户学习成本,提高操作便捷性。
功能丰富:提供丰富的功能,如文件传输、语音视频通话、群组管理等,满足用户多样化需求。
五、跨操作系统技术支持
技术培训:为用户提供技术培训,帮助用户了解IM解决方案的使用方法和技巧。
技术支持:设立技术支持团队,及时解决用户在使用过程中遇到的问题。
持续更新:根据用户反馈和市场需求,不断优化IM解决方案,提高用户体验。
总之,IM解决方案支持跨操作系统,需要从平台选择、兼容性、数据同步、用户体验和技术支持等方面进行综合考虑。只有满足这些要求,才能为用户提供优质、稳定的跨操作系统IM解决方案,助力企业信息化建设。
猜你喜欢:环信即时通讯云